President Nechirvan Barzani Meets Iraqi Prime Minister in Baghdad to Discuss Regional Stability

President Nechirvan Barzani held a high-level meeting with Iraqi Prime Minister Mohammed Shia' Al-Sudani in Baghdad this morning, focusing on recent developments in Iraq, regional stability, and other pressing issues.
In a statement following the meeting, President Barzani described the discussions as "productive," emphasizing the importance of cooperation between the Kurdistan Region and the federal government in addressing key challenges.
The meeting comes at a critical time as Iraq continues to navigate political, economic, and security challenges. Both leaders reaffirmed their commitment to fostering dialogue and coordination to ensure lasting stability in the country and the broader region.
